Plead my cause, and deliver me: quicken me according to thy word.

Bible References

Plead

Psalm 35:1
Argue my case, LORD, against those who argue against me. Fight against those who fight against me.
Psalm 43:1
You be my judge, God, and plead my case against an unholy nation; rescue me from the deceitful and unjust man.
1 Samuel 24:15
May the LORD act as judge, and may he decide between me and you. May he see, may he plead my case, and may he vindicate me in this dispute against you."
Job 5:8
"Now as for me, I would seek God if I were you; I would commit my case to God.
Proverbs 22:23
for the LORD will plead their case and ruin the lives of those who ruin them.
Jeremiah 11:20
LORD of the Heavenly Armies, the righteous judge, the one who tests feelings and the heart, let me see your vengeance on them, for I've committed my cause to you.
Jeremiah 50:34
Their Redeemer is strong, the LORD of the Heavenly Armies is his name. He will vigorously plead their case in order to bring rest to the earth, but turmoil to the inhabitants of Babylon.
Jeremiah 51:36
Therefore this is what the LORD says: "Look, I'm going to argue your case and take vengeance for you. I'll dry up her sea and make her fountain dry.
Micah 7:9
I will endure the LORD's anger since I have sinned against him until he takes over my defense, administers justice on my behalf, and brings me out to the light, where I will gaze on his righteousness.
1 John 2:1
My little children, I'm writing these things to you so that you might not sin. Yet if anyone does sin, we have an advocate with the Father Jesus, the Messiah, one who is righteous.
